Robert De Niro, who famously called himself the best actor he's ever worked with, goes to war with another Robert De Niro in the trailer for the upcoming biographical crime thriller The Alto Knights.
Even with that 90% Rotten Tomatoes threshold (which generally indicates a movie's worth your time) in place, the range of releases is impressive. This month, Prime Video subscribers can enjoy ...